In a Danfoss SH scroll compressor, the
compression is performed by two scroll elements
located in the upper part of the compressor.
Suction gas enters the compressor at the suction
connection. As all of the gas ows around and
through the electrical motor, thus ensuring
complete motor cooling in all applications, oil
droplets separate and fall into the oil sump.
After exiting the electrical motor, the gas enters
the scroll elements where compression takes
place. Ultimately, the discharge gas leaves the
compressor at the discharge connection.
The gure below illustrates the entire
compression process. The centre of the orbiting
scroll (in grey) traces a circular path around
the centre of the xed scroll (in black). This
movement creates symmetrical compression
pockets between the two scroll elements.
Low-pressure suction gas is trapped within
each crescent-shaped pocket as it gets formed;
continuous motion of the orbiting scroll serves
to seal the pocket, which decreases in volume
as the pocket moves towards the centre of the
scroll set increasing the gas pressure. Maximum
compression is achieved once a pocket reaches
the centre where the discharge port is located;
this stage occurs after three complete orbits.
Compression is a continuous process: the
scroll movement is suction, compression and
discharge all at the same time.

SH range is composed of SH090-105-120140-161-184 (light commercial platform) and
SH180-240-295-300-380-485 (large commercial
platform).
The SH090-105-120-140-161-184 compressors
bene t from a further improved design to
achieve the highest e ciency.
• Gas circulation, motor cooling and oil
behaviour are improved on light commercial
platform models by a new patented motor cap
design.
• Part protection and assembly reduces internal
leaks and increases life durability.
Heat shield that lowers the heat
transfer between discharge and
suction gas and the acoustic level
• Improved part isolation reduces greatly
acoustic levels.
• Gas intake design induces higher resistance to
liquid slugging.
The SH485 compressors include additional
features for enhanced protection and e ciency:
• integrated discharge gas temperature
protection,
• intermediate discharge valves for higher
seasonal e ciency.
• patented gas path ow.

Oil drain connection
The oil drain connection allows oil to be
removed from the sump for changing, testing,
etc. The tting contains an extension tube into
the oil sump to more e ectively remove the
oil. The connection is a
female 1/4" are tting
incorporating a schrader valve and is mounted on
SH180 - 240 - 295 - 300 - 380 - 485 models only.
